diff --git a/src/pages/work/base/creditCard/addEdit.vue b/src/pages/work/base/creditCard/addEdit.vue index 2cacc0c..da845c6 100644 --- a/src/pages/work/base/creditCard/addEdit.vue +++ b/src/pages/work/base/creditCard/addEdit.vue @@ -31,6 +31,14 @@ + + + + + + @@ -118,7 +126,9 @@ const data = reactive({ billDate: null, payDate: null, delayPeriod: null, + balance: null, creditLimit: null, + availableLimit: null, effectiveDate: null, cvv: null, createBy: null, @@ -139,6 +149,8 @@ const data = reactive({ billDate: [{ type: 'number', required: true, message: '账单日不能为空', trigger: ['change', 'blur'] }], payDate: [{ type: 'number', required: true, message: '还款日不能为空', trigger: ['change', 'blur'] }], creditLimit: [{ type: 'number', required: true, message: '信用卡额度不能为空', trigger: ['change', 'blur'] }], + balance: [{ type: 'number', required: true, message: '余额不能为空', trigger: ['change', 'blur'] }], + availableLimit: [{ type: 'number', required: true, message: '可用额度不能为空', trigger: ['change', 'blur'] }], } }) const { form, rules} = toRefs(data) diff --git a/src/pages/work/base/debitCard/addEdit.vue b/src/pages/work/base/debitCard/addEdit.vue index bdbe7c8..8a554ea 100644 --- a/src/pages/work/base/debitCard/addEdit.vue +++ b/src/pages/work/base/debitCard/addEdit.vue @@ -19,6 +19,10 @@ + + + @@ -85,6 +89,7 @@ const data = reactive({ payDate: null, delayPeriod: null, creditLimit: null, + balance: null, effectiveDate: null, cvv: null, createBy: null, @@ -99,6 +104,7 @@ const data = reactive({ rules: { name: [{ type: 'string', required: true, message: '储蓄卡名称不能为空', trigger: ['change', 'blur'] }], code: [{ type: 'string', required: true, message: '储蓄卡卡号不能为空', trigger: ['change', 'blur'] }], + balance: [{ type: 'number', required: true, message: '余额不能为空', trigger: ['change', 'blur'] }], debitTypeName: [{ type: 'string', required: true, message: '储蓄卡类型不能为空', trigger: ['change', 'blur'] }], } }) diff --git a/src/pages/work/base/lend/addEdit.vue b/src/pages/work/base/lend/addEdit.vue index d0df25f..9a79c7f 100644 --- a/src/pages/work/base/lend/addEdit.vue +++ b/src/pages/work/base/lend/addEdit.vue @@ -24,7 +24,14 @@ inputAlign="right" border="none"> - + + + + + + @@ -73,7 +80,9 @@ const data = reactive({ billDate: null, payDate: null, delayPeriod: null, + balance: null, creditLimit: null, + availableLimit: null, effectiveDate: null, cvv: null, createBy: null, @@ -88,6 +97,7 @@ const data = reactive({ rules: { name: [{ type: 'string', required: true, message: '借贷名称不能为空', trigger: ['change', 'blur'] }], code: [{ type: 'string', required: true, message: '账号不能为空', trigger: ['change', 'blur'] }], + balance: [{ type: 'number', required: true, message: '余额不能为空', trigger: ['change', 'blur'] }], lendTypeName: [{ type: 'string', required: true, message: '类型不能为空', trigger: ['change', 'blur'] }], } })